#634798 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#634798 is composed of 38.8% red, 27.8%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 34.9% cyan, 53.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 260.7 degrees, a saturation of 36.3% and a lightness of 43.7%. #634798 color hex could be obtained by blending #c68eff with #000031. Closest websafe color is: #663399.

Shades and Tints of #634798

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030205 is the darkest color, while #f8f7f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#634798

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6e6976 is the less saturated color, while #4e02dd is the most saturated one.

Color Blindness Simulator

Below, you can see how #634798 is perceived by people affected by a color vision deficiency. This can be useful if you need to ensure your color combinations are accessible to color-blind users.

Monochromacy
  • #595959 Achromatopsia 0.005% of the population
  • #5b5566 Atypical Achromatopsia 0.001% of the population
Dichromacy
  • #335ca7 Protanopia 1% of men
  • #356097 Deuteranopia 1% of men
  • #5d5f66 Tritanopia 0.001% of the population
Trichromacy
  • #4454a2 Protanomaly 1% of men, 0.01% of women
  • #455697 Deuteranomaly 6% of men, 0.4% of women
  • #5f5678 Tritanomaly 0.01% of the population
